Sex Dreams About The Office Can Pay Off

July 14, 2011 No Comments

They say, “don’t judge a book by its cover.” In that same logic, don’t judge a dream’s content at face value.

To a certain extent, you probably already know not to do that. But when you have a steamy dream about a co-worker or a boss, it’s hard not believe that it simply means you are attracted to them. Dreams are supposed to be an expression of our subconscious and sexual thoughts are the ones we repress the most; putting two and two together seems easy enough, no?

Well, sex dreams often aren’t actually about the sex part but rather about the setting around them.

“Dreams are a conversation with the self,” Lauri Loewenberg, a dream analyst, explains. During sleep, “We are left with our deepest, most insightful and brutally honest thoughts.”

That might mean that the dream where you got hot and heavy with that awful guy from accounting is actually revealing to you an important quality about that co-worker you dismissed until then. Pay attention to the hidden messages; they could actually guide you through your career moves to personal fulfillment.

“Nothing in a dream is random,” Loewenberg says.

But don’t get too caught in dream analysis. If there is someone you find super cute in your department and you have wet dreams about them, I’m no dream expert but, you should probably ask them out.
